For All classic British cars, every wiring colour serves a particular purpose across all vehicles, so, with these codes, one look at any cable tells you exactly where it is going to - and from - and what it is ignition, battery or intermediate, fused or unfused, etc. No more guesswork.
The BS wiring colours I found on Marcel Chichak's site.
